Outreach Ministry
  1. World Missions - We believe God has given the local church the great commission to preach the Gospel to all nations (Matthew 28:19-20; Mark 16:15). At Susquehanna Valley Baptist Church we strive to use every Biblical means to reach our community and around the world.
  2. Weekly Visitation and Canvasing - SVBC makes a serious effort to take the Gospel to people in their homes. We carefully canvas our community street by street, and house by house searching for people who are willing to accept Jesus Christ as their personal Savior.
  3. New Comers Class - Going to a new church can sometimes be scary and confusing. Not all churches are the same so we offer a new comers class for those who want to learn more about SVBC and how we do things at our church.
  4. Spring/Fall Surveying - We conduct a community survey two times a year to learn more about the people in the community surrounding SVBC. By doing this it allows our church to more effectively reach our neighbors.
  5. Hospital Visitation - Many times those who are in the Hospital no mater how big or small the reason is need someone to come and encourage them. We take time to visit those who are in the Hospital.
